Senior Enlisted LeaderUnited States Naval Academy Mar 2023 - PresentAnnapolis, Maryland, United StatesThe Marine cadre at the United States Naval Academy engages and educates all midshipmen regarding the mission and organization of the United States Marine Corps, its relationship with the U.S. Navy, and opportunities for service as Marine Officers. Via strategic communications and formal USMC training, USNA Marines seek to recruit, select, and train highly qualified midshipmen for service as commissioned officers in the United States Marine Corps. The final result desired is to commission Marine Second Lieutenants who are prepared for the rigors of The Basic School and service as Marine officers. Marine Corps officers and staff noncommissioned officers are fully integrated into all aspects of midshipman training, education and development by serving as course instructors, company officers and senior enlisted leaders, as well as club/sports coaches and team representatives, summer training facilitators, and Marine company mentor. -

Usmc Drill Instructor, Experienced Drill Instructor, Senior Drill InstructorUnited States Marine Corps Oct 2009 - Oct 2012Beaufort, South Carolina, United StatesA drill instructor is a non-commissioned officer responsible for training recruits from the moment they arrive at one of two Marine Corps boot camp locations, to the moment they officially become Marines after 13 weeks of training. Drill Instructors deliver training to volunteer-civilians during recruit training. Drill Instructors supervise and instruct, or assist in commanding and instructing, a recruit platoon. As a United State Marine Corps Drill Instructor, it is mandatory to have a high degree of maturity, leadership, judgment, and professionalism. -
Motor Transportation And Training OfficerUnited States Marine Corps Sep 2004 - Mar 2009Camp PendletonMotor vehicle operators operate motor transport tactical wheeled vehicles and equipment transporting passengers and cargo in support of combat and garrison operations. They also perform crew/operator level maintenance and maintain all associated tools and equipment for assigned vehicles and equipment, to rated capacity, of which licensed to operate.Perform Preventive Maintenance Checks and Services on motor transport equipment; Operate motor transport equipment; Perform emergency procedures on motor transport equipment; Ensure cargo is loaded properly; Perform ground guide procedures; Operate load handling system (LHS) on motor transport equipment.Perform Maintenance Automated Information System (MAIS) related functions on motor transport equipment; Manage a publication library; Handle hazardous material; Research operator/crew maintenance information; Transport hazardous cargo; Operate fuel delivery system; Operate water delivery system.
